The Web Application Hacker's Handbook: Finding and Exploiting Security Flaws
by Dafydd Stuttard and Marcus PintoA must-read for understanding web vulnerabilities, this book empowers beginners to navigate security flaws in web apps effectively.
Hacking: The Art of Exploitation
by Jon EricksonThis classic introduces hacking concepts with practical examples, ensuring you understand both theory and application in a hands-on manner.
Metasploit: The Penetration Tester's Guide
by David Kennedy, Jim O'Gorman, Devon Kearns, and Mati AharoniEssential for mastering Metasploit, this book provides practical insights into penetration testing techniques using this powerful tool.
Kali Linux Revealed: Mastering the Penetration Testing Distribution
by Raphael Hertzog and Jim O'GormanA comprehensive guide to Kali Linux, this book helps you set up your hacking lab and understand the tools at your disposal.
The Hacker Playbook 2: Practical Guide To Penetration Testing
by Peter KimThis engaging guide offers step-by-step penetration testing methodologies, making it accessible for beginners eager to apply their skills.
Cybersecurity Essentials
by Charles J. Brooks, Christopher Grow, Philip Craig, and Donald ShortA foundational text that covers essential cybersecurity concepts, providing context for ethical hacking within a broader framework.
Ethical Hacking and Penetration Testing Guide for Beginners
by Rohit TammaAn excellent starting point for newcomers, this book simplifies ethical hacking concepts and offers practical exercises for skill development.
Network Security Assessment: Know Your Network
by Chris McNabFocuses on assessing network security, this book equips you with the skills to identify vulnerabilities and enhance defenses.
